Description of the policy/measure
This program promotes the development of new cultural participants with a positive and participative intervention around the cultural heritage, opening new channels for expressing their artistic curiosity under suitable conditions. the project is aimed at senior citizens, migrant groups, people with special needs, people living at a hospital or hospice, inmates at social readaptation centers children and youth at risk, among others.it also brings together in its design and application the country's 31 states and mexico city on cultural matters through joint programs between the federal, state and municipal governments along with the society's participation.聽

Results achieved
Some of the most significant results are: promoting among the previously mentioned audiences the access, participation and enjoyment of cultural goods and services; producing projects which have as guiding principle the culture of inclusion and that work towards raising awareness about the difficulties faced by people with special needs; creating, along with聽 cultural聽 institutions聽 in聽 the states, political policies and programs that encourage specific sectors of society to approach the different cultural and artistic聽 expressions.
Financial resources allocated to the policy
From 2012 to 2015, the federal government contributed with $10,726,500 mxn.
Evaluation of the policy/measure
The state institutions of culture made a two-part contribution through a joint fund with the聽 secretariat of culture with which 22,298 cultural inclusion activities were supported, reaching 137,681 people.currently, 26 states take part in the program: aguascalientes, baja california norte, baja california sur, campeche, chiapas, chihuahua, coahuila, durango, estado de mexico, guanajuato, guerrero, hidalgo, jalisco, michoacan, morelos, puebla, queretaro, quintana roo, san luis potosi, sinaloa, sonora, tabasco, tamaulipas, tlaxcala and zacatecas.
